Control Panel Configuration
Transition execution section
Fader lever: Move the lever up and down to execute the 
transition.
Transition indicator: Displays the progress of the 
transition with 24 LEDs. The number of lit LEDs 
increases as the transition proceeds.
Transition rate display section: Displays the specified 
transition rate (the time from the start to the end of the 
transition, in units of frames).
See “Setting Transition Rates” (page 69) for more 
information about how to specify transition rates.
AUTO TRANS (transition) button: Press to execute a 
transition automatically at the specified transition rate. 
The transition begins immediately, and the button 
lights in amber. The button goes out when the 
transition finishes.
CUT button: Press to execute an instant transition.
Next transition selection buttons
To specify which part of the video to switch (change) in 
the next transition, press one of the following buttons, 
turning it on.
BKGD (background): Switches the background video in 
the next transition.
KEY1, KEY2: Press the [KEY1] button, turning it on, to 
insert key 1 into the background in the next transition, 
or to delete it from the background. If key 1 is not 
currently inserted, the transition inserts it. If key 1 is 
currently inserted, the transition deletes it. The 
[KEY2] button works in the same way.
KEY PRIOR (priority): When key 1 and key 2 are 
inserted in an overlapping state, the key on top appears 
in front on the monitor. By pressing this button, 
turning it on, you can reverse the priority of the two 
keys in the next transition.
OVER indicators
When key 1 and key 2 are inserted, the OVER indicator for 
the key on top lights.
Transition type selection buttons
To select the type of transition, press one of the following 
buttons, turning it on.
MIX: In a background transition, the new video overlaps 
the current video, finally replacing it. During the 
transition, the sum of the output levels of the A bus and 
the B bus is maintained at 100%.
In a key transition, the key fades in (for insertion) or 
out (for removal).
EFF (effect): A transition using the selected effect pattern 
is executed.
See “Selecting Effects” (page 56) for more 
information about how to select effects.
PST (preset) COLOR MIX : This is a two-stage mix 
(dissolve), comprising two transitions. In the first 
transition, a color matte is gradually mixed into the 
current video. In the second transition, the new video 
is gradually mixed into the color matte.
You can perform both of these operations in a single 
transition. 
KEY1 ON and KEY2 ON buttons
Press the corresponding button to instantly insert or delete 
key 1 or key 2. The [KEY1 ON] button lights in red when 
key 1 is inserted into the program video (final output 
video). Otherwise it lights in amber. The [KEY2 ON] 
button works in the same way.
PGM/PST Transition Control Block
Use this block to control program transitions.
This control block is provided only on the 1.5 M/E and 1.5 
M/E wide panels.
